Nail CareBack in 1999-2000, it was Connie who brought me for my 1st pedicure. We went to a small shop in city plaza. Small, squeezy and 'not so hygiene' shop but good skills. The manicurist was so confident that I can keep my nails long, nice and beautiful after few treatments! Trusted her so much that I frequent them every 3 weeks. Indeed, thru the months, my toe nails became longer, beautiful, besides, my heels / sole became smoother and softer, lesser dry and hard skin.
Beginning 2002, I decided to pick up the skills, t4, started scouting around for workshops until Lynn and myself found NAILBAR, The Specialist Center, we signed up for the basic mani & pedi course. Just before we completed the basic course, we decided to take up the full professional course. The course includes nail scrulptures, acrylic and gel applications, nail anatomy, nail extensions etc... We took about 4 months to complete the course, that includes alot of hands on practice on real models.

You can try out gel nails which are now becoming a hot favorite as they are natural looking even without nail tips and the best way for nail enhancement. Also, if you are allergic to those strong smelling chemicals which you can experience with acrylic nails, then you should use gel nails as these are odorless.
However, when you are planning on gel nail application, make sure you approach a nail salon or a nail artist who is well versed with gel nails and is properly trained and mastered in gel applications. This will save you from problems that can arise with improper gel nail applications.
